<div dir="ltr"><div><div>Thank you very much for this. Those darn markers have bit me a few times.<br></div>Cheers,<br></div>Scarlett<br></div><div class="gmail_extra"><br><div class="gmail_quote">On Fri, Oct 16, 2015 at 3:59 AM, Harald Sitter <span dir="ltr"><<a href="mailto:sitter@kde.org" target="_blank">sitter@kde.org</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">It has happened more than once that git threw a merge conflict and in<br>
a hurry someone didn't resolve the conflict properly but simply git<br>
add a conflicting file. This leaves lingering merge markers (>>>>>><br>
<<<<<<) in the file and potentially goes unnoticed for a long time as<br>
some files are not actually parsed at build time and thus the merge<br>
markers do not cause a build failure.<br>
<br>
I now added tech to detect this in the QA stage of all KCI builds [1]<br>
and raise integration errors if markers were found. If you notice a<br>
false positive please poke me.<br>
<br>
[1] <a href="http://anonscm.debian.org/cgit/pkg-kde/ci-tooling.git/commit/?id=1da12af7c6acff5ac391c7da571cd599f1d31a79" rel="noreferrer" target="_blank">http://anonscm.debian.org/cgit/pkg-kde/ci-tooling.git/commit/?id=1da12af7c6acff5ac391c7da571cd599f1d31a79</a><br>
<span class="HOEnZb"><font color="#888888"><br>
HS<br>
<br>
--<br>
kubuntu-devel mailing list<br>
<a href="mailto:kubuntu-devel@lists.ubuntu.com">kubuntu-devel@lists.ubuntu.com</a><br>
Modify settings or unsubscribe at: <a href="https://lists.ubuntu.com/mailman/listinfo/kubuntu-devel" rel="noreferrer" target="_blank">https://lists.ubuntu.com/mailman/listinfo/kubuntu-devel</a><br>
</font></span></blockquote></div><br></div>